วิธีเปิดใช้งานการรองรับ MSE & H.264 บน YouTube สำหรับ Firefox ในขณะนี้

อัปเดต : Firefox รองรับคุณสมบัติสื่อ HTML5 ทั้งหมดที่ YouTube ต้องการ เมื่อคุณเปิดหน้าทดสอบ HTML5 คุณจะสังเกตเห็นว่ามีการตรวจสอบตัวเลือกทั้งหมดเพื่อระบุว่าได้รับการสนับสนุนทั้งหมด โปรดทราบว่าการกระจาย Linux บางอย่างอาจไม่รองรับคุณสมบัติบางอย่าง ปลาย

เมื่อคุณเปิดหน้า HTML5 ของ YouTube ใน Firefox รุ่นล่าสุดที่มีความเสถียรในขณะนี้คุณจะสังเกตเห็นว่าการสนับสนุนไม่พร้อมใช้งานสำหรับเทคโนโลยีทั้งหมดที่มีอยู่ในหน้า

การสนับสนุนอาจพร้อมใช้งานสำหรับ HTMLVideoElement, H.264 และ WebM VP8 แต่ไม่สามารถใช้ได้กับ Media Source Extensions, MSE & H.264 หรือ MSE & WebM VP9

ตัวเลือกการกำหนดค่าพร้อมใช้งานเพื่อเปิดใช้งาน Media Source Extensions และ MSE & WebM VP9 ในเบราว์เซอร์ Firefox ทันที

โดยให้โหลด about: config ในแถบที่อยู่ของเบราว์เซอร์และค้นหาคำว่า media.mediasource.enabled คลิกสองครั้งที่การตั้งค่าเพื่อตั้งค่าเป็นจริงหากยังไม่ได้ตั้งค่าเป็นจริงแล้ว

จากนั้นค้นหา media.mediasource.webm.enabled หลังจากนั้นและตรวจสอบให้แน่ใจว่าได้ตั้งค่าเป็นจริงเช่นกัน หากไม่เป็นเช่นนั้นให้ดับเบิลคลิกเพื่อเปลี่ยนค่าเป็นจริง

เมื่อคุณกลับไปที่หน้า HMTL5 ของ YouTube หลังจากนั้นคุณจะสังเกตเห็นว่ามีเพียงรายการ MSE & H.264 ที่ระบุว่าไม่รองรับในขณะที่รองรับตัวเลือกที่เหลือทั้งหมด

หากคุณไม่ทำเช่นนั้นคุณจะได้รับความละเอียดเลือกวิดีโอใน YouTube เมื่อใช้เครื่องเล่นวิดีโอ HTML5 เท่านั้น นี่เป็นปัญหาอย่างมากเนื่องจาก Google จะบังคับให้ผู้ใช้ Firefox ใช้โปรแกรมเล่นวิดีโอ HTML5 จาก Firefox 33

Mozilla ยังไม่ได้เปิดใช้งานคุณลักษณะนี้ตามค่าเริ่มต้นแม้จะไม่ใช่ Firefox รุ่นล่าสุดทุกคืน นี่เป็นตัวบ่งชี้ว่าคุณลักษณะยังไม่พร้อมสำหรับช่วงไพร์มไทม์และอาจต้องใช้เวลาสองสามรอบก่อนที่จะเปิดใช้งานตามค่าเริ่มต้น

ความละเอียดวิดีโอส่วนใหญ่จะใช้งานได้หลังจากที่คุณเปิดใช้งาน Media Source Extensions ใน Firefox สิ่งที่ยังไม่ได้รับการสนับสนุนหลังจากนั้นคือ MSE & H.264 ซึ่งหมายความว่าวิดีโอบางรายการอาจไม่เล่นในความละเอียดทั้งหมดที่อยู่ในไซต์

เปิดใช้งาน MSE & H.264

การตั้งค่าใหม่ใน Firefox Nightly 34 มีการเปลี่ยนแปลงอย่างไรก็ตามดังนั้นการสนับสนุนเทคโนโลยีที่ร้องขอทั้งหมดจะได้รับหลังจากนั้นบน YouTube

หมายเหตุ : ในขณะที่บทความมุ่งเน้นไปที่แพลตฟอร์มการโฮสต์วิดีโอของ Google การเปิดใช้งานการสนับสนุน MSE & H.264 จะเป็นประโยชน์ต่อผู้ใช้เบราว์เซอร์บนเว็บไซต์อื่นเช่นกัน

คุณต้องสร้างการตั้งค่าใหม่ที่จะทำ:

  1. พิมพ์ about: config และกด Enter
  2. ยืนยันว่าคุณจะระมัดระวัง
  3. คลิกขวาและเลือกใหม่> บูลีน
  4. ตั้งชื่อการตั้งค่า media.mediasource.ignore_codecs
  5. ตั้งค่าเป็น True

อัพเดต: ผู้ใช้ Linux อาจเปลี่ยนค่ากำหนดต่อไปนี้เช่นกัน:

  1. media.mediasource.mp4.enabled เป็นจริง
  2. media.fragmented-mp4. * เป็นจริง
  3. media.fragmented-mp4.use-blank-decoder เป็นเท็จ

หากคุณกลับไปที่หน้า HTML ของ YouTube คุณควรเห็นเทคโนโลยีทั้งหกรายการที่ระบุว่ารองรับ (เป็นสีเขียว)

ข้อบกพร่องหลายอย่างจะต้องได้รับการแก้ไขก่อนที่ Mozilla จะเปิดใช้งานคุณสมบัติโดยตรงสำหรับผู้ใช้เบราว์เซอร์ทุกคน คุณสามารถตรวจสอบความคืบหน้าของ mediasource ได้ที่นี่

ซึ่งหมายความว่าคุณอาจได้รับการแฮงค์หรือประสบปัญหาอื่น ๆ หลังจากเปิดใช้งานการสนับสนุนคอนเทนเนอร์ mp4 สำหรับ Media Source Extensions ในเบราว์เซอร์

ถึงกระนั้นมันก็ดีที่เห็นว่า Mozilla กำลังทำงานเพื่อรองรับคุณสมบัติใน Firefox มันไม่ชัดเจนว่ามันจะจัดการแก้ไขปัญหาทั้งหมดก่อนที่จะปล่อย Firefox 33 เนื่องจากอาจส่งผลให้มีการร้องขอการสนับสนุนเพิ่มขึ้นเมื่อผู้ใช้ Firefox สังเกตเห็นว่า YouTube ให้บริการแก้ปัญหาบางอย่างเท่านั้น